Transaction 58e1b77ccbb939ce374bb290f18308689f9225673058a8a78422bf79066f4da1
1 Input
1 Output
-
58e1b77ccbb939ce374bb290f18308689f9225673058a8a78422bf79066f4da1:0
- value
- 7699427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89de6975f55f00a9736c0c1d1bdeadd4704a143b OP_EQUAL
- address
- 3EFzwH5xU7i4cboRv1ZdGynfipkCufBxHC